Subject: Replica lag alarm — ownership change

Future maintainers: the Norrbeck read-replica lag alarm has moved to the Datastore Reliability group. Thresholds, paging rules, and the suppression window during nightly backfills are all theirs now. Do not tune the alarm without their review; silent tweaks have burned us before. All changes and incident escalations now route to the person named below.

account owner for bawip-tahag: Raleth Quenok

Runbook: Hopper cache release (Glowcart KV tier)

The bloom filter fronting the Glowcart key-value store must be rebuilt before the new node pool takes traffic. Expect ~4 min of elevated miss rates; do not page storage on-call unless misses exceed 20% past 10 minutes. Support should tell customers that stale reads are expected during the window, not data loss. Rebuild job ships as a signed bundle from the Ferndale build host. Verify the bundle with the deploy key below before triggering the rebuild.

signing key of bagap-yawep = bky13_TbfT6ZMUoGJo2

During the Veldrane diagram editor release candidate, CI flagged intermittent failures in the undo/redo suite. The history stack test assumes deterministic command IDs, but the new Fennwick layout engine assigns them lazily, so redo occasionally replays a stale node position. We pinned the ID generator seed in test setup and the flake rate dropped to zero across 200 reruns. Please hold the RC until the pinned seed lands on the release branch. The verifying build token is recorded directly below.

pipeline stamp: htk21_86b657ac0aa916a9af17f

Runbook: Lanternwire WS reconnect loop. Symptom: clients hammer the gateway after a dropped socket because backoff resets on every 1006 close. Fix shipped in gatewayd 4.2.1 caps retries at 6 with jitter. To verify, tail the reconnect counter on the Brambleton staging node and confirm it plateaus. If the loop persists, restart socket-broker and drain stale sessions via the sweep endpoint. The sweep endpoint requires auth against the Quillpost internal service; use the key below.

gateway credential: kto23_LX9A4ys6i4nzHtpOLNLodKK